Superchunk - Tossing Seeds [Singles 1989-91] LP

NEW. SEALED.

BACK IN PRINT!!! SUPERCHUNK's Tossing Seeds (Singles 89-91) is available on vinyl after a long hiatus. Recorded at Duck Kee Studios and Chicago Recording Company, Tossing Seeds is a collection of rare and early Superchunk singles. The LP includes the anthemic “Slack Motherfucker,” a single that helped define the sound of North Carolina’s music scene in the ‘80s and ‘90s. Originally released in 1992 on Merge, this reissue is remastered from the original tapes, pressed to 180-gram vinyl, and includes a full album download code. The 2016 LP jacket, unlike previous pressings, includes images collected from the original singles that combined to make Tossing Seeds (Singles 89-91).
